The Valuation
Ask two or three agents to give you a valuation on your home, and consider the following: -
-
Ask them - why should I give you my house to sell? Carefully consider their answer. Ask yourself, were you convinced did they tell you what their service would mean to you?
-
How did they justify their valuation? Did they discuss with you details of other similar houses that they have sold recently? Ask the agent who suggests the highest figure how they reached their opinion; they may simply want to secure your business and then pressurise you to reduce your asking price at a later stage.
-
Do you get on with the agent now, and do you think you will get on with him or her when things get tough? Do you feel happy letting this person deal with the biggest asset that most people own?
-
Are you clear about what they will charge - ask them to convert the fee into £££'s and add the VAT so that you know exactly what you will be liable for, and when!
Remember that by law the agent cannot put your home on the market until they have confirmed in writing your instructions, their fee and when it is to be collected.
